Artist Info
 
Dominic John is a renowned classical music artist who has made a significant impact in the music industry. Born in London, England, on May 15, 1985, Dominic showed an early interest in music, and his parents encouraged him to pursue his passion. He began playing the piano at the age of five and quickly developed a natural talent for the instrument. As a child, Dominic was exposed to a wide range of musical genres, but he was particularly drawn to classical music. He spent countless hours listening to recordings of great composers such as Beethoven, Mozart, and Chopin, and he was inspired by their ability to create beautiful and complex pieces of music. At the age of ten, Dominic began taking piano lessons with a local teacher, and he quickly progressed to a level where he was able to perform in public. He made his debut performance at a local music festival, where he received a standing ovation for his rendition of Beethoven's Moonlight Sonata. From that moment on, Dominic was determined to pursue a career in music. He continued to study the piano, and he also began to explore other instruments, including the violin and the cello. He was a gifted musician, and he quickly gained a reputation as one of the most talented young musicians in London. In 2003, Dominic was accepted into the Royal Academy of Music, one of the most prestigious music schools in the world. He studied under some of the most renowned music teachers in the industry, and he honed his skills as a pianist and a composer. During his time at the Royal Academy of Music, Dominic had the opportunity to perform in some of the most prestigious concert halls in the world, including the Royal Albert Hall and the Barbican Centre. He also won several awards for his performances, including the prestigious Royal Academy of Music Piano Prize. After graduating from the Royal Academy of Music, Dominic began to establish himself as a professional musician. He performed in concerts all over the world, and he quickly gained a reputation as one of the most talented and versatile musicians in the industry. One of the highlights of Dominic's career was his performance at the Proms, one of the most prestigious classical music festivals in the world. He performed a solo piano recital, which was broadcast live on BBC Radio 3. The performance was a huge success, and it cemented Dominic's reputation as one of the most talented young musicians in the industry. In addition to his work as a performer, Dominic is also an accomplished composer. He has written several pieces of music, including a piano concerto that was premiered by the London Symphony Orchestra. His compositions have been praised for their beauty and complexity, and they have been performed by some of the most renowned orchestras in the world. Throughout his career, Dominic has won numerous awards and accolades for his work as a musician. He has been awarded the prestigious Gramophone Award, the Classical Brit Award, and the International Classical Music Award. He has also been nominated for several Grammy Awards, and he is widely regarded as one of the most talented and accomplished musicians of his generation. Despite his success, Dominic remains humble and dedicated to his craft. He continues to perform in concerts all over the world, and he is constantly pushing himself to improve as a musician.
